The global automotive automation market was gearing up for a transformation between 2024 and 2028, projected to grow by USD 2.45 billion with a compound annual growth rate (CAGR) of 4.36%. Traders were eyeing this shift closely, considering the implications of heightened manufacturing flexibility and smart methodologies reshaping the industry.
Smart Manufacturing Revolution: The AI Push
The push toward smart manufacturing was central to this evolution. As automotive production processes grew more complex, manufacturers sought out automation technologies that harnessed artificial intelligence (AI). The integration of advanced tech like industrial sensors and programmable logic controllers (PLCs) represented a fundamental shift. These innovations enabled real-time data processing, predictive maintenance, and operational flexibility—elements crucial for ramping up productivity in the highly competitive automotive sector.
Visibility Equals Agility: IoT-Driven Decisions
Manufacturers increasingly recognized that enhanced visibility throughout production was key to remaining agile. IoT-enabled sensors collected vital data feeding into decision-making systems that monitored every aspect of production in real time. This immediacy not only boosted efficiency but also allowed quick adaptations to shifting market demands—a game changer in an industry marked by volatility.

Legacy Systems: A Drag on Progress?
A primary roadblock remained the legacy systems many companies clung to. These outdated control mechanisms were not built for today's security landscape and upgrading them could drain resources faster than you could say 'automation.' Many firms were hesitant; after all, who wants to gamble hefty investments on technology upgrades while facing potential security threats? This reluctance left numerous organizations vulnerable as they navigated an increasingly dangerous digital terrain.
Trade Wars Complicating Supply Chains
Adding fuel to the fire were trade wars and supply chain interruptions hitting hard especially in electronics—the lifeblood of modern automation solutions. Disruptions here could stall adoption rates of AI-driven technologies needed for streamlining production processes even further.
- Technological Segmentation: Key players include industrial sensors, PLCs, Manufacturing Execution Systems (MES), Supervisory Control and Data Acquisition (SCADA) systems, and Distributed Control Systems (DCS). Each technology served as a cog in improving automation capabilities across operations.
- Diverse End-User Demographics: Vehicle manufacturers along with component suppliers were pumping capital into automation strategies—not merely aiming for efficiency but also pushing boundaries on product innovation within their respective markets.
